Brain Network Changes Accompanying and Predicting Responses to Pharmacotherapy in OCD

Recruiting now · Phase 1/Phase 2 · Has a placebo group

Conditions studied: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der

In brief

The proposed randomized, double-blind research study will use functional magnetic resonance neuroimaging using state-of-the-art HCP acquisition protocols and analytic pipelines, to identify predictors and correlates of response to an accepted first-line pharmacological treatment for obsessive-compulsive disorder.
